Kconfig 1.9 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122
  1. if ARCH_MSM
  2. choice
  3. prompt "Qualcomm MSM SoC Type"
  4. default ARCH_MSM7X00A
  5. config ARCH_MSM7X00A
  6. bool "MSM7x00A / MSM7x01A"
  7. select ARCH_MSM_ARM11
  8. select MSM_SMD
  9. select MSM_SMD_PKG3
  10. select CPU_V6
  11. select MSM_PROC_COMM
  12. config ARCH_MSM7X30
  13. bool "MSM7x30"
  14. select ARCH_MSM_SCORPION
  15. select MSM_SMD
  16. select MSM_VIC
  17. select CPU_V7
  18. select MSM_REMOTE_SPINLOCK_DEKKERS
  19. select MSM_GPIOMUX
  20. select MSM_PROC_COMM
  21. config ARCH_QSD8X50
  22. bool "QSD8X50"
  23. select ARCH_MSM_SCORPION
  24. select MSM_SMD
  25. select MSM_VIC
  26. select CPU_V7
  27. select MSM_REMOTE_SPINLOCK_LDREX
  28. select MSM_GPIOMUX
  29. select MSM_PROC_COMM
  30. endchoice
  31. config MSM_SOC_REV_A
  32. bool
  33. config ARCH_MSM_ARM11
  34. bool
  35. config ARCH_MSM_SCORPION
  36. bool
  37. config MSM_VIC
  38. bool
  39. menu "Qualcomm MSM Board Type"
  40. config MACH_HALIBUT
  41. depends on ARCH_MSM
  42. depends on ARCH_MSM7X00A
  43. bool "Halibut Board (QCT SURF7201A)"
  44. help
  45. Support for the Qualcomm SURF7201A eval board.
  46. config MACH_TROUT
  47. depends on ARCH_MSM
  48. depends on ARCH_MSM7X00A
  49. bool "HTC Dream (aka trout)"
  50. help
  51. Support for the HTC Dream, T-Mobile G1, Android ADP1 devices.
  52. config MACH_MSM7X30_SURF
  53. depends on ARCH_MSM7X30
  54. bool "MSM7x30 SURF"
  55. help
  56. Support for the Qualcomm MSM7x30 SURF eval board.
  57. config MACH_QSD8X50_SURF
  58. depends on ARCH_QSD8X50
  59. bool "QSD8x50 SURF"
  60. help
  61. Support for the Qualcomm QSD8x50 SURF eval board.
  62. config MACH_QSD8X50A_ST1_5
  63. depends on ARCH_QSD8X50
  64. select MSM_SOC_REV_A
  65. bool "QSD8x50A ST1.5"
  66. help
  67. Support for the Qualcomm ST1.5.
  68. endmenu
  69. config MSM_DEBUG_UART
  70. int
  71. default 1 if MSM_DEBUG_UART1
  72. default 2 if MSM_DEBUG_UART2
  73. default 3 if MSM_DEBUG_UART3
  74. choice
  75. prompt "Debug UART"
  76. default MSM_DEBUG_UART_NONE
  77. config MSM_DEBUG_UART_NONE
  78. bool "None"
  79. config MSM_DEBUG_UART1
  80. bool "UART1"
  81. config MSM_DEBUG_UART2
  82. bool "UART2"
  83. config MSM_DEBUG_UART3
  84. bool "UART3"
  85. endchoice
  86. config MSM_SMD_PKG3
  87. bool
  88. config MSM_PROC_COMM
  89. bool
  90. config MSM_SMD
  91. bool
  92. config MSM_GPIOMUX
  93. bool
  94. config MSM_V2_TLMM
  95. bool
  96. endif